A
Aqueous Inks

Aqueous (water-based) inks offer sharp printing, high gloss, durable adhesion, water resistance, and exceedingly low VOC levels. Unlike soy inks, water-based inks are flexible and do not crack or flake when folded.

B
Back Weld

In bag making, a seal formed by heat-pressing two overlapping layers of thermoplastic material.

Biodegradable

Capable of decomposing under natural conditions. In certain states, the term "biodegradable" legally applies only to products which meet the ASTM D 6400 standard.

Bioplastics

Plastics manufactured from resins derived from renewable resources such as corn or potato starch, and hemp or soybean oil rather than petroleum. They are sustainable and biodegradable, but have different performance characteristics than traditional petroleum-based materials. One of the more common bioplastics is Polylactic Acid (PLA), derived from corn starch.

Bleed

Artwork which extends beyond the trim area. This acts as a buffer, allowing for natural variations in cutting and processing.
